I really don't see how Kevin Johnson will hold up in the pro game. He had to put on weight to get to 188 lbs, which has clearly slowed him down as he ran his forty in the 4.5 range. He looks like a string bean even with the weight gain. I would be hesitant to draft a player in the first who will be playing with additional weight he is not used to carrying. 

 

Granted, Johnson looks like a great cover guy, but a HUGE liability in run support.
